Home
last modified time | relevance | path

Searched refs:BindingDeclaration (Results 1 – 15 of 15) sorted by relevance

/external/dagger2/java/dagger/internal/codegen/binding/
DBindingDeclaration.java31 public abstract class BindingDeclaration { class
45 public static final Comparator<BindingDeclaration> COMPARATOR =
47 (BindingDeclaration declaration) ->
53 (BindingDeclaration declaration) -> declaration.bindingElement(),
DBindingDeclarationFormatter.java39 public final class BindingDeclarationFormatter extends Formatter<BindingDeclaration> {
55 public boolean canFormat(BindingDeclaration bindingDeclaration) { in canFormat()
69 public String format(BindingDeclaration bindingDeclaration) { in format()
DModuleDescriptor.java92 public ImmutableSet<BindingDeclaration> allBindingDeclarations() { in allBindingDeclarations()
93 return ImmutableSet.<BindingDeclaration>builder() in allBindingDeclarations()
104 return allBindingDeclarations().stream().map(BindingDeclaration::key).collect(toImmutableSet()); in allBindingKeys()
DOptionalBindingDeclaration.java34 abstract class OptionalBindingDeclaration extends BindingDeclaration {
DSubcomponentDeclaration.java37 public abstract class SubcomponentDeclaration extends BindingDeclaration {
DBindingNode.java84 public final Iterable<BindingDeclaration> associatedDeclarations() { in associatedDeclarations()
DDelegateDeclaration.java44 public abstract class DelegateDeclaration extends BindingDeclaration
DMultibindingDeclaration.java48 public abstract class MultibindingDeclaration extends BindingDeclaration
DBinding.java49 public abstract class Binding extends BindingDeclaration {
DBindingGraphFactory.java298 private static <T extends BindingDeclaration>
300 return ImmutableSetMultimap.copyOf(Multimaps.index(declarations, BindingDeclaration::key)); in indexBindingDeclarationsByKey()
963 static <T extends BindingDeclaration>
/external/dagger2/java/dagger/internal/codegen/bindinggraphvalidation/
DDuplicateBindingsValidator.java40 import dagger.internal.codegen.binding.BindingDeclaration;
273 Iterable<? extends BindingDeclaration> bindingDeclarations) { in formatDeclarations()
278 private ImmutableSet<BindingDeclaration> declarations( in declarations()
283 .sorted(BindingDeclaration.COMPARATOR) in declarations()
287 private ImmutableSet<BindingDeclaration> declarations( in declarations()
289 ImmutableSet.Builder<BindingDeclaration> declarations = ImmutableSet.builder(); in declarations()
DMapMultibindingValidator.java35 import dagger.internal.codegen.binding.BindingDeclaration;
207 ImmutableList.sortedCopyOf(BindingDeclaration.COMPARATOR, contributionsForOneMapKey), in duplicateMapKeyErrorMessage()
/external/dagger2/java/dagger/internal/codegen/kythe/
DDaggerKythePlugin.java38 import dagger.internal.codegen.binding.BindingDeclaration;
121 for (BindingDeclaration bindingDeclaration : in addEdgesForDependencyRequest()
130 DependencyRequest dependency, BindingDeclaration bindingDeclaration) { in addDependencyEdge()
/external/auto/common/src/test/java/com/google/auto/common/
DOverridesTest.java195 abstract static class BindingDeclaration implements HasKey { class in OverridesTest.MoreTypesForInheritance
201 extends BindingDeclaration implements HasBindingType, HasContributionType {
/external/dagger2/java/dagger/internal/codegen/bootstrap/
Dbootstrap_compiler_deploy.jarMETA-INF/ META-INF/MANIFEST.MF build-data.properties META-INF ...